What Does The Institutional Ownership Tell Us About V.S.T. Tillers Tractors?

Institutional investors commonly compare their own returns to the returns of a commonly followed index. So they generally do consider buying larger companies that are included in the relevant benchmark index.

V.S.T. Tillers Tractors already has institutions on the share registry. Indeed, they own 22% of the company. This implies the analysts working for those institutions have looked at the stock and they like it. But just like anyone else, they could be wrong. If multiple institutions change their view on a stock at the same time, you could see the share price drop fast. It's therefore worth looking at V.S.T. Tillers Tractors's earnings history, below. Insider Ownership Of V.S.T. Tillers Tractors

The definition of company insiders can be subjective, and does vary between jurisdictions. Our data reflects individual insiders, capturing board members at the very least. Management ultimately answers to the board. However, it is not uncommon for managers to be executive board members, especially if they are a founder or the CEO.

I generally consider insider ownership to be a good thing. However, on some occasions it makes it more difficult for other shareholders to hold the board accountable for decisions.

It seems insiders own a significant proportion of V.S.T. Tillers Tractors Limited. Insiders own ₹3.6b worth of shares in the ₹8.1b company. This may suggest that the founders still own a lot of shares. You can click here to see if they have been buying or selling.
